インターネット経由で送信されるデータの量を確認する方法はありますか?

インターネット経由で送信されるデータの量を確認する方法はありますか?

ドイツの大規模ISP(Telekom)は最近、DSLインターネット接続容量を月75 GBに制限することにしました。

今私がどれだけダウンロード/アップロードしたか知りたいです。私はLinux Mint 14 Nadiaを使用し、D-LINK DI-524ルーターを持っています。

月にアップロード/ダウンロードされたデータの量をどのように知ることができますか?

答え1

ユーザーフレンドリーなGUIアプリケーションを探している場合はお勧めしますdownload monitor。統計の表示やクォータの割り当てなどの操作を実行できます。
シンプルでクールなCLIの選択肢は次のとおりです。vnstatどのように)。

答え2

出力にはifconfigパケットとバイトカウンタが含まれ、通常はシステム起動後の数がリストされます。

/proc/net/devこの情報は、機械が読みやすい形式で提供することもできます。

答え3

完全性を確保するために、一部のルータ(具体的な例はCisco Small Businessモデル)が管理インターフェイスを介して送信されたデータ量に関する情報を提供することにも注意する価値があります。 Webインターフェイスに数字を表示するだけでなく、指定した間隔でカウンタをリセットし、レポートを電子メールで送信し、制限を適用するように設定できます。

DI-524には特にそのような機能があるかどうかはわかりませんが、管理インターフェースを確認することをお勧めします。ルーターは通常頻繁に再起動されないため、比較的有用なデータを提供することができます。

答え4

いくつかの方法があり、そのうちの1つはvnstatをダウンロードすることです。

apt-get install vnstat

その後、最初に設定します。

vnstat -u -i eth0
vnstat -u -i wlan0

その後、ステータスを確認するには、端末にこのコマンドを入力する必要があります。

vnstat -m

関連情報